Emma Dennis

As a blind attorney, I bring a unique and deeply personal perspective to my work in helping individuals with disabilities and their families navigate a society that wasn’t designed with their needs in mind. Having lived these challenges firsthand, I am not only passionate about advocating for the rights of people with disabilities but also deeply empathetic to the struggles they face in accessing essential resources and support systems.

I graduated from The Ohio State University with a Bachelor of Arts in Criminology and Psychology in May 2021, followed by earning my Juris Doctor from The Ohio State University Moritz College of Law in May 2024. After passing the July 2024 Uniform Bar Examination with a score high enough to practice in any UBE jurisdiction, I was admitted to practice law in Ohio on November 12, 2024.

Throughout my own life, I've gained firsthand experience with programs like Medicaid waivers, Social Security, Individual Education Plans (IEPs), Opportunities for Ohioans with Disabilities (OOD), and Developmental Disabilities Boards. This personal insight, combined with my legal training, empowers me to effectively assist clients with disabilities in overcoming barriers and securing the support they need to thrive.

I also have the privilege of working alongside my guide dog, Pepper, a compact black lab from Leader Dogs for the Blind. She’s committed to her work but knows how to relax with some popcorn, treats, and her favorite squeaky toy.

Estess, Kim

Kim Estess, Esq., is dually certified as a specialist in elder law by the National Elder Law Foundation and the Ohio State Bar Association and certified as a specialist in Estate Planning, Trust, and Probate Law by the OSBA.

Her practice focuses on estate planning, estate administration, elder law, asset protection, Medicaid, special needs planning and guardianships.

"I firmly believe that providing outstanding service requires more than just excellent legal work — it also involves taking the time to establish a strong relationship with each client in order to truly understand their unique family situation and goals," she says.

Kammer, David D.

David D. Kammer has been practicing law for over 28 years and has only represented individuals. He seeks to treat his clients with dignity, respect, and kindness.

His office serves clients in the areas of estate planning (Wills, trusts, powers of attorney, and living wills), estate and trust administration, and long-term and crisis nursing home Medicaid planning.

Our planning and advice in each of these areas is enhanced by our in-depth knowledge of tax consequences for individuals and their beneficiaries.

O’Diam, Brittany D.

Brittany D. O'Diam, CELA, is a dually Certified Specialist in Elder Law by the OSBA and the National Elder Law Foundation, and she is also an OSBA Certified Specialist in Estate Planning, Trust & Probate Law. Brittany concentrates her practice on estate planning, estate administration, guardianships, Medicaid, asset protection, special needs planning and elder law. She is a member of the National Academy of Elder Law Attorneys (Past-President, Ohio Chapter); ElderCounsel, LLC, a national network of elder law attorneys; WealthCounsel, LLC, a national organization of estate planning attorneys; Ohio State Bar Association (Vice Chair, Elder & Special Needs Law Section); Florida Bar Association, Dayton Bar Association (Estate Planning, Trust and Probate Committee; and Greene County Bar Association. Brittany also serves as an Ohio Department of Medicaid Stakeholder Liaison, the Chair of the Board of Trustees for The Disability Foundation, and a member of the Business Advisory Council for the Greene County Educational Services Center.

Brittany devotes much of her time to educating the public as well as professional advisors and service organizations about estate planning, as well as the options available to help the elderly and special needs population. She received her BS in Journalism cum laude from Ohio University, and her JD cum laude from the University of Akron School of Law. She is licensed to practice in both Ohio and Florida, and she lives in Beavercreek, Ohio with her husband and their two children.

Sutton, Maggie L.

Maggie L. Sutton has worked with Richard Taps since 2011. She is a graduate of Indiana University Kelley School of Business with a degree in Accounting. Maggie received her law degree from Capital University in 2011, cum laude, where she was both Secretary and Treasurer of the Board of the Women’s Law Association. She is a volunteer with the Legal Aid Society, helping elderly and low-income individuals with their estate planning needs.

Prior to law school, Maggie worked in Chicago as a tax accountant for a large accounting firm. She has experience preparing business and individual tax returns for high net worth individuals.

Maggie is certified in elder law by the National Elder Law Foundation. There are only 30 attorneys in Ohio who are certified in elder law.

Maggie grew up in Worthington and lives there with her husband and children. She enjoys reading, exercising, running half marathons, and sewing. She also enjoys rooting on the Buckeyes and Colts during football season and the Hoosiers during basketball season.
